In light of President Obama’s State of the Union speech urging Americans to "win the future" through increased innovation, business leaders joined administration officials to help launch the "Startup America" initiative, an effort to stimulate more entrepreneurship and innovation. In his speech, the President stated, "Entrepreneurs embody the promise of America. That’s why we’re launching Startup America, a national campaign to help with the future by knocking down barriers in the path of men and women in every corner of this country hoping to take a chance, follow a dream, and start a business."

During the launch event, White House officials announced increased corporate investment and support from companies including Intel, Hewlett-Packard, IBM and Facebook. A blog post by Facebook commented, "[We] will provide new companies with assistance building new apps and incorporating social technology."
